About Advanced Sterilization Products (ASP)

Advanced Sterilization Products is a global leader in infection prevention solutions. Headquartered in Irvine, California, USA and founded in 1987, ASP develops innovative sterilization and disinfection technologies that help protect patients and healthcare professionals during critical moments of care. Our mission is to elevate global standards of infection prevention and contribute to safer, more effective healthcare practices.
